Last week the President signed into law a measure to extend the $8,000 first time home buyers tax credit through April 30, 2010. It was scheduled to expire at the end of this month.

He also extended the new home buyer tax incentives to people who have owned a home for at least five years. Meaning if you’re an existing homeowner, you qualify for the new tax credit of up to $6,500 if you have lived in your current residence for five years or more out of the previous eight years and purchase a home or sign a sales contract for one from November 7 to the end of April of next year.


Austin has been pretty lucky on the real estate front. Still I’ve always wondered where people are having the most success selling.

Thanks to Brian Talley of the Regent Property Group, there’s a way to make sense of the numbers. He put together this terrific list  that shows how many homes have sold in various Austin neighborhoods since the beginning of the year.

So here are the top ten neighborhoods and the number of homes that have sold in them since the beginning of 2009:

Circle C    238
Milwood   205
Steiner Ranch   199
Avery Ranch    153
Cherry Creek   133
Village at Western Oaks  124
Brushy Creek   78
Maple Run    77
Scofield Farms  77
Belterra    76
